On Thursday evening the Business Women’s Association Book Club invited me as their guest author. It was a fun event held at the Lion's Kloof Lodge in Higgovale. About twenty guests arrived and enjoyed soup and a glass of wine, sat at a long dinner table. The presentation went well, and my book seemed like a popular choice. It was a memorable evening. Huge leaps away from the stereo typical image of a book club, as... well... a touch dry. Not so with the 'Go-getter' members of the BWA. The atmosphere was friendly, fun and full of life, a definate must for any business woman wanting to join a book club with a lot of Zing.
